WebMar 2, 2024 · When conducting your audit, we will ask you to present certain documents that support the income, credits or deductions you claimed on your return. You would have used all of these documents to prepare your return. Therefore, the request should not require you to create something new.

WebThere are different types of IRS tax audits. The specific timeframe needed to complete an audit can vary depending on the underlying circumstances. In most cases, the IRS completes an audit between a few months to one year from the date it was initiated. The Internal Revenue Manual specifies that audits must be closed no more than 26 months ... Keep records for 3 years from the date you filed your original return or 2 years from the date you paid the tax, whichever is later, if you file a claim for credit or refund after you file your return.
